Hurston Waldrep struck out 12 in six innings, and Florida homered three times in the first four innings to take a four-run lead on Oral Roberts.

Then things got interesting at the College World Series — again.

The Gators took control of Bracket 1 with a 5-4 victory Sunday night. But first Florida had to survive Matt Hogan's inside-the-park home run that pulled ORU within two runs, a bases-loaded situation in the eighth when its closer was forced out of the game because of a mound-visit rules violation, and finally another threat in the ninth.

"These past couple of games that have been played early on in the World Series have been kind of like thrill seekers towards the last couple innings," Gators shortstop Josh Rivera said.

For the first time in CWS history, which dates to 1947, five of the first six games have been decided by one run.

"I think people here in Omaha are getting their money’s worth," ORU coach Ryan Folmar said.

The Gators (52-15) will play Wednesday against the winner of the Tuesday elimination game between ORU and TCU. Florida would have two chances, if needed, to get the one win that would send it to the best-of-three finals beginning Saturday.

The Summit League's Golden Eagles (52-13), the first No. 4 regional seed since 2012 to play in the CWS, are known to punch above their weight, but they looked outclassed early
